(4) Where an offer of amends under this section is accepted by
the party aggrieved—
(a) any question as to the steps to be taken in fulfilment of
the offer as so accepted shall in default of agreement
between the parties be referred to and determined by the
High Court, whose decision thereon shall be final;
(b) the power of the Court to make orders as to costs in
proceedings by the party aggrieved against the person
making the offer in respect of the publication in question,
or in proceedings in respect of the offer under paragraph
7(4)(a), shall include power to order the payment by the
person making the offer to the party aggrieved of costs
on an indemnity basis and any expenses reasonably incurred
or to be incurred by that party in consequence of the
publication in question,
and if no such proceedings as aforesaid are taken, the High Court
may, upon application made by the party aggrieved, make any
such order for the payment of such costs and expenses as aforesaid
as could be made in such proceedings.
(5) For the purposes of this section words shall be treated as
published by one person (in this subsection referred to as the
publisher) innocently in relation to another person if and only if
the following conditions are satisfied, that is to say—
(a) that the publisher did not intend to publish them of and
concerning that other person, and did not know of
circumstances by virtue of which they might be understood
to refer to him; or
(b) that the words were not defamatory on the face of them,
and the publisher did not know of circumstances by virtue
of which they might be understood to be defamatory of
that other person,
and in either case that the publisher exercised all reasonable care
in relation to the publication; and any reference in this subsection
to the publisher shall be construed as including a reference to any
servant or agent of his who was concerned with the contents of
the publication.
